Once I was residing in Rome, I missed “American issues,” akin to free water at eating places, air-con, driving round locations, massive grocery shops, and simply listening to English round me. However now that I’ve been house for about three weeks, I’ve realized one thing humorous. The Italian habits rapidly turned my new regular. Coming again house has truthfully felt just a little unusual at instances as a result of I’ve gotten so used to a unique life-style for almost 4 months.

A humorous second was once I got here again and realized I might all of the sudden perceive everybody round me once more. In Rome, I had gotten so used to listening to conversations throughout me with out understanding what folks have been saying; it simply blended into the background. Once I obtained house, I used to be amazed as a result of once I walked into shops, I might really perceive different folks’s conversations. There was English all over the place. I forgot what that was like, though I had solely been away for 4 months.

I additionally actually missed how informal Individuals gown at instances. In Rome, folks at all times seemed so put collectively, even when they have been simply strolling round casually. I obtained used to placing effort into outfits each day. I might even change out of the comfortable garments I wore round my condo into denims and a jacket simply to run to the grocery retailer down the road. Coming house and instantly seeing folks in outsized sweatshirts and sweatpants on the retailer stood out to me, however I used to be so completely happy to simply do the identical and never really feel misplaced.

Even grocery shops felt overwhelming as soon as I returned. Italian grocery shops have been often smaller and solely carried a couple of choices for meals and kitchen gadgets. I used to need to go to 1 retailer for garments, one other for notebooks and pencils, and one other for meals. Having all these issues in a single massive place feels just a little totally different now. I cherished strolling by means of my native Meijer after coming house and truly appreciating its measurement and one-stop-shop comfort.

It’s humorous how rapidly a brand new place can begin to really feel regular. I spent months adjusting to life in Italy, and with out realizing it, a few of these habits and routines turned a part of me too. Being house has made me notice that finding out overseas adjustments you in small methods you don’t even discover till you come again.
